Version Text
Hebrew והנה־הוא שם עלילת דברים לאמר לא־מצאתי לבתך בתולים ואלה בתולי בתי ופרשו השמלה לפני זקני העיר׃
Greek αυτος νυν επιτιθησιν αυτη προφασιστικους λογους λεγων ουχ ευρηκα τη θυγατρι σου παρθενια και ταυτα τα παρθενια της θυγατρος μου και αναπτυξουσιν το ιματιον εναντιον της γερουσιας της
Latin imponit ei nomen pessimum, ut dicat : Non inveni filiam tuam virginem : et ecce hæc sunt signa virginitatis filiæ meæ. Expandent vestimentum coram senioribus civitatis :
KJV And, lo, he hath given occasions of speech against her, saying, I found not thy daughter a maid; and yet these are the tokens of my daughter's virginity. And they shall spread the cloth before the elders of the city.
WEB and behold, he has accused her of shameful things, saying, 'I didn't find in your daughter the tokens of virginity;' and yet these are the tokens of my daughter's virginity." They shall spread the cloth before the elders of the city.
